General description

Diol-functionalized silica gel is less polar and has lower retention time when compared to normal phase silica gel.

Application

Diol-functionalized silica gel may be used as stationary phase for liquid chromatographic analysis.

G K Jayaprakasha et al.
Journal of chromatography. B, Analytical technologies in the biomedical and life sciences, 937, 25-32 (2013-09-10)
Rapid separation, characterization and quantitation of curcuminoids are important owing to their numerous pharmacological properties including antimicrobial, antiviral, antifungal, anticancer, and anti-inflammatory activities. In the present study, pseudo two-dimensional liquid flash chromatography was used for the separation of four curcuminoids
